Output d6179613b6c58e8e285095a27b724d18c98e5330d4e7625c24973b432637fd42:4

value
32172073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b54a08c381bbc155b4ae2e4a2e9f96b9f8cf58 OP_EQUAL
address
MHGELC31p4VUVQsHPgMunuADd5j2DGSmqG
transaction
d6179613b6c58e8e285095a27b724d18c98e5330d4e7625c24973b432637fd42
spent
true